Essential graduate and faculty research tips

  1. Keep up to date with the latest research by using alerts.
  2. Find important journals for medicine, science, social science and technology using journal citation reports.
  3. Get to know your subject librarian.
  4. Manage your citations by using a citation management tool.
  5. Use UVicSpace to find UVic research and submit your own for increased exposure (student theses and faculty publications).
  6. Get resources from other libraries using interlibrary loan.
  7. Find out about grants and awards
